SLB has been awarded a contract by Brunei Shell Petroleum to support production restoration from shut-in wells across multiple offshore fields. The contract spans subsurface evaluation, well candidate selection, engineering and offshore execution within a single coordinated model. It marks the first deployment of SLB's integrated production restoration solution for the operator, bringing together multiple disciplines to optimise recovery from mature offshore assets while supporting the company's long-term production objectives.

 

Details of the Contract

 

SLB has secured a significant contract in Brunei. The award comes from Brunei Shell Petroleum. It covers support for production restoration efforts. The focus is on shut-in wells across offshore fields. These fields span multiple offshore locations.

The contract has a comprehensive scope of work. It spans subsurface evaluation and well candidate selection. Engineering and offshore execution are also included. Project management and intervention services form part of the scope. Monitoring, metering and marine logistics complete the coverage.
